Hi

I have a strange problem, I don't know whether it's a bug or not. In museum I can find some liners, for example, Chatham transport, Cunard Liner etc. All of them are described as 'Passenger Liner' and have the same tonnage - 24 000 if US ship and 18 000 if british. I checked .cfg files. They look normal, I mean Chatham has 5,649 BRT, large old liner has 14 000. The same issue can be noticed when you see the medium tankers ( T2 and Empire Celt tanker). Although there're correct (and different) values in their .cfg files, both of these units have the same tonnage. I don't want it to be so please, tell me what should I change to get correct tonnage values.

Ok I think I got it. First I changed in EnglishNames.cfg from Passenger Liner to, for example 'Chatham Transport', then in roster directory edited NCHT.cfg file and set 'Display Name=Chatham Transport'. Now it works correct, hope you understood my problem, thanks for reply.

Yes, that was a minor problem with the museum descriptions. All ships which have the same name under Englishnames.cfg will have the same description as one of those ships.

Oh yes, the recognition manual and actual tonnages will work perfectly fine.:yep: The only problem is that the descriptions in the museum will be wrong, but that is a minor issue and I think it is worth it for the generic ship contacts, which do help the game.

The generic names allow for more realistic manual ship identification, and is a compromise between specific names for merchants and the universal 'contact' designation in GW 1.1a. At least that's the way I understand it.

Normally, I would strongly warn against changing any GWX files. But in this case, we are talking about a simple text file, and so if you really have a problem with the museum description mix-ups, you can change the names in Englishnames.cfg or Germannames.cfg so that each merchant has its own name. (A couple of them are listed twice with two different names but don't worry about that - in such a situation, SHIII will choose the first name in the list).
